What's Happening?
ESPN analyst Greg McElroy has praised Arch Manning's recent performance, noting significant improvements in his gameplay. Manning, the quarterback for Texas, showcased his skills in a 34-31 victory over
Vanderbilt, completing 25-of-33 passes for 328 yards and three touchdowns, achieving a season-high QBR of 93.1. McElroy highlighted the Longhorns' offensive improvements, particularly their ability to protect Manning, which has been a critical factor in his development. Previously, Manning faced challenges, including being sacked eight times in two games, but the recent game against Vanderbilt demonstrated a turnaround with no sacks or turnovers. McElroy believes Texas is poised to play its best football as they head into November, potentially disrupting playoff predictions.

What's Next?
Texas has a bye week before facing No. 5 Georgia on November 15, a game that could further test Manning's capabilities and the team's readiness to compete at a higher level.
